Mrs. Carl Elsie “Jim” Jeffcoat, age 86, died Saturday morning, August 13, 2011, in Ozark Health and Rehabilitation Center.

Funeral services will be 10:30 A. M. Tuesday, August 16, 2011, from Ozark Baptist Church with Reverend Dr. Steve King and Reverend Harry Circle officiating. Interment will follow at 1:30 P. M. in Green Hills Cemetery in Troy, Alabama, Holman Funeral Home of Ozark directing.

The family will be at the funeral home Monday from 5:00 P. M. until 7:00 P. M.

Mrs. Jeffcoat was born July 19, 1925 in Troy to the late James Willie Bradley and Lillie Holifield Bradley. She and her late husband, Asa Lambert “Junior” Jeffcoat, Jr., owned and operated Troy Laundry and Cleaners and later One Hour Martinizing Cleaners in Ozark. In addition to her parents and her husband, she was preceded in death by two sisters, Kathleen Bozeman and Irma Shirley.

Survivors include one son, Jack Jeffcoat of Ozark;

two grandchildren, Jill and Michael Bledsoe of Huntsville, Jason Jeffcoat of Andalusia;

four great grandchildren;

and one sister and brother-in-law, Dolly and Bill Drinkard of Henderson, Alabama.

Several nieces and nephews also survive.
